This review found that technique selection and application by chiropractors treating infants and young children are typically modified in force and speed to suit the age and development of the child.
Clinical outreach to Rarotonga provided a broad case mix of patients and a change in student perceptions of preparedness to practice with children, which was positively affected by the total number of children managed and the number of children managed who were under 10 years of age.
